Of All The House MD Quotes (The Two I Remember Most)

John Henry Giles: (To House) “You don’t risk jail and your career to save somebody doesn’t want to be saved unless you got something, anything... one thing. The reason normal people got wives and kids and hobbies, whatever, that’s because they ain’t got that one thing that... that hits them that hard and that true. I got music. You got THIS, the thing you think about all the time, thing that keeps you south of normal. Yeah, makes us great, makes us the best. All we miss out on is everything else - no woman waiting at home after work with a drink and a kiss. That ain’t gonna happen for us. So when it’s over, it’s over.”

House: “You and I have found out that being normal sucks. Because we’re freaks. The advantage of being a freak is that it makes you stronger… But how strong do you really want her to have to be???”

I think the biggest reason why these two quotes really stand out for me is a quote my grandfather shared with his family when my dad and his siblings were growing up… He said “We’re not going to beat each other down in this house… the rest of the world will do more than enough of that all on its own, without our help.”.
I have often wondered over the course of my life… “What’s the point of being strong???” (or, if you prefer, exceptional). For me it’s the ability to adapt, to change with my circumstances rather than be dictated by them. I am very grateful for the person I have turned out to be, but I recognize that trying to be stronger has left a lot of us weaker. Like a person whom exercises more than what their body can recover from, we are breaking down. We all need healing, time to recover, a little release, and a chance to embrace other qualities of life.
Let’s put doing/having more, getting stronger, being better, and fixing things ourselves on hold for a little while and embrace that maybe we’re better off getting some help once in a while (preferably before hitting bottom).
Let’s not beat ourselves or each other up… this world will do enough of that all on it’s own, without our help.
